We are seeking a highly skilled and innovative AI Framework Developer to join our dynamic team and significantly contribute to groundbreaking AI initiatives within Simcenter STAR-CCM+.
Simcenter STAR-CCM+ is a highly scalable, general-purpose, multi-physics application that provides an end-to-end user experience with integrated CAD, meshing, physics modeling, and in-situ post-processing tools. This role offers a unique opportunity to work at the intersection of advanced engineering simulation and artificial intelligence.
You will be a core member of our Interoperability team, focusing on developing the AI Agents framework for STAR-CCM+ and integrating Simcenter Physics AI capabilities. This position also involves close collaboration with other specialized teams within the Interoperability division, fostering a truly collaborative and impactful environment. A key aspect of this role will be working with Model Context Protocol (MCP), exploring the integration of Large Language Models (LLMs), and leveraging AI Reduced Order Models to enhance our simulation tools.
